On September 22, 2012, Moghuls Inc. launched the first 4 episodes of its web series Cha Do. Punjabi for “Give Me Tea”, Cha Do is a comedy that follows a pair of South Asian siblings (Talia and Ajay) whose family runs an Indian Restaurant. Add in their cousin Sal (short for Salman) and their other 4 friends, and hilarity ensues as together they navigate the marriage of two very different cultures (South Asian and American).

The partners of Moghuls Inc.- Mona Barkat, Rasha Goel and Lorna Clarke Osunsanami – wanted to give the South Asian community a platform to be something other than the stereotype and voice the comedy and difficulties of growing up and being part of an immigrant family here in the US.

Committed also to having an overall multicultural platform, the cast portrays a cultural mix of friends. This gives Cha Do not only a South Asian appeal, but also a mix of other cultures as well!
